The Chicago Sun-Times is reporting that the Bears may have to put newly signed RB Kevin Jones on PUP list to start the season. Jones, who signed a one-year deal with the Bears Tuesday, tore the ACL in his right knee back on December 23rd vs the Chiefs. He has been working hard to make it all the way back, and checked out with the Bears doctors enough for them to offer him a deal.

Jones was coming off an injury last season with the Lions and started the year on the PUP (physically unable to perform) list. If he starts the year on that list, he will not be able to take the field till at least week six, which is what he did last season with Detroit.
